Wave X Pro AI Agents Indicator
Wave X Pro is a signal-analysis indicator developed for MetaTrader 5 and designed for short-duration binary trading workflows. It operates on the M1 chart and presents directional signals with a five-minute evaluation period.
The indicator combines several specialized analytical modules in one coordinated workflow. Each module examines a different aspect of price behavior before the system presents its final signal. Wave X Pro is an analytical tool. It does not execute trades automatically But It can automate your trades in binary brokers like pocket broker with the help of mt2trading like aumation systems.

Live-Market and OTC-Style Symbols
Wave X Pro is designed to work with compatible symbols made available in the MetaTrader 5 terminal. This can include standard live-market symbols and broker-provided OTC-style symbols when suitable chart data is available.
Symbol names, price feeds, trading sessions and data quality vary between brokers. Availability on one broker does not guarantee identical behavior on another broker. The user should verify each symbol on a demo account before using the indicator in a live trading workflow.
